Win propels Galaxy five points clear

Jwaneng Galaxy returned to winning ways in the Botswana Premier League (BPL) after defeating BDF XI 2-1 at the National Stadium this afternoon to tighten their grip at the top of the standings.

Galaxy completed a double over the army side which moves the leaders five points clear of second placed Township Rollers with nine games before the curtain comes down on the season. However, the diamond miners had to do it the hard way against BDF XI after trailing 1-0 at the break. Oratile Taunyane broke the deadlock in the 23rd minute but soon after the break, Lesagaripa levelled the scores through forward Daniel Msendami. Leading goal scorer, Thabang Sesinyi netted the winner with 21minutes to full time, as he took his season's tally to 14 goals. Galaxy are back in action against Morupule Wanderers on Saturday while Rollers face a tough task against Gaborone United in the Gaborone derby.
